back to topic, i think that was possible when the position LIB (libero) was in the game in WE6, when i set one of my CBs to LIB, i always see him up front when playing set pieces
 
i've heard if you want your CB into the box during CK's what to do is to put him on an Attack Arrow (same way of attackin) and remove\turn a Defense Arrow (blue one into cyan one).
i tested it yesterday with Samuel and Materazzi of F.C. Inter, and worked out fine,except for having both in;so i think it will work only with one defender,but i've to figure it out better!!
